Dynamic interactions between epithelial skin cells and a sensory cavity sculpt the growing olfactory orifice
Abstract During morphogenesis and in pathological conditions, gaps can form in the plane of epithelial barriers upon cellular forces that disrupt intercellular junctions. How the size of these epithelial holes further increases over time and what sets their shape remain poorly understood.
Actomyosin contractility in olfactory placode neurons opens the skin epithelium to form the zebrafish nostril
Despite their barrier function, epithelia can locally lose their integrity to create physiological openings during morphogenesis. The mechanisms driving the formation of these epithelial breaks are only starting to be investigated. Here, we study the formation of the zebrafish nostril (the olfactory orifice), which opens in the skin epithelium to expose the olfactory neurons to external odorant cues.
